And what's more, Mankins has a legitimate beef -- against the CBA, granted, more than the Patriots. He was screwed by the extra RFA year.

Umenyiora, though, is no victim. He's not "underpaid" because of the salary written into this year of his deal. He chose, while still in his rookie contract, to sign a SEVEN-year extension that was heavily front-loaded.

A contract like that involves tradeoffs on both sides. The team takes the risk of paying out a big guaranteed payment, but benefits by having the player tied up long term, and gets the upside if the player does well. The player gets the security of cash upfront, enough to set him up for life even if he suffers a career-ending injury in game one, but gives up the potential upside. IOW, Osi chose the safe and conservative path, rather than gambling on his own success. But now he wants it both ways.
